Ruling coalition agrees to hold elections on November 20



KATHMANDU: The top leaders of the five-party ruling coalition have agreed to hold provincial and federal elections on November 20.

According to sources, the election will be announced at the cabinet meeting tomorrow (Thursday).

Earlier, the Election Commission had suggested holding the election on November 18, but Prime Minister and Nepali Congress President Sher Bahadur Deuba had been mulling over holding it on November 4.

In addition to reaching an agreement on the election date, the coalition meeting discussed about the performance of the local election.
